BAA"s Scottish airports experienced a strong month in September and maintained the "solid performance" shown in the summer, the operator has announced.
Edinburgh airport saw its busiest September on record with a 3% increase in passengers compared to the same period in 2010.
Traffic grew by 3.2% at Glasgow, while Aberdeen continued a recent run of positive results with an 11.3% rise in traveller numbers, partly thanks to an oil industry conference in the city.
At other BAA airports, Southampton experienced its third consecutive month of increasing passenger figures with a 0.7% jump, while Heathrow achieved a record September for customers, aircraft movements and the number of seats filled per plane.
The North Atlantic market continued to show the fastest growth at the London hub, with a 3.5% year-on-year rise in the number of people catching flights to the region.
BAA chief executive Colin Matthews welcomed the positive figures but stressed the importance of addressing capacity constraints in the UK, which are making it difficult for airports such as Heathrow to compete with European hubs like Frankfurt and Paris Charles de Gaulle.
